An Opportunity To Tell the Government What’s Right With Non-compete Agreements
The Federal Trade Commission seeks public comment related to its future role in restricting the use of non-compete clauses in employer-employee contracts. The comment period ends on March 11, 2020. Comments may be submitted electronically or in paper...
